# Formula sandbox client setup.
# All user-supplied formulas run inside the Grimstone evaluator — never eval
# locally. The sandbox strips I/O, caps CPU at 200ms, and rejects recursion
# deeper than 32 frames. New folks: don't widen those limits without sign-off
# from the Pellbright runtime team. The evaluator authenticates with the
# internal key below.

service key, tadup-tahog: zpat7_wB1tnEL

The Graywell retention sweeper runs nightly and purges records past policy age across the Corvid datastore. If customers report data lingering past retention, check the sweeper's last run status before escalating. Partial runs are normal during heavy load; the sweeper resumes from its checkpoint. Do not trigger manual sweeps without engineering sign-off — a misconfigured manual run once purged active accounts at Thornby Analytics. When investigating, first confirm the sweeper is operating with the following configuration values.

config for bawig-fadup:
[zorix]
host = zorix.lumicworks.corp
user = zorix_svc
database = zorix_prod

## Who to contact — Scanline barcode integration

Scanline is our bridge between the warehouse handhelds and the Cartfox inventory service. If you're doing a security review, the folks who own the firmware handshake and the payload signing bits sit on the Dockside team — they're quick to answer questions about cert rotation and scope of the scanner tokens. Anything that smells like an injection vector through scanned payloads counts too. Drop your findings at the address below.

escalation mailbox, bafog-fafog: ulador@paliqlabs.internal

**Q: Why does a Brightmoor deep link open the app but land on the home screen?**

A: This usually means the route isn't registered in the link manifest, so the router falls back to home. Confirm the path matches the manifest exactly, including trailing segments. The full routing table and fallback rules are documented here.

operations page: https://jenkins.zemvarcloud.local/job/merge_requests/repo/build/73930b4b30f0a8ed